Primary school teacher charged again

A teacher at Adélard-Desrosiers Elementary School in Montreal North, in Montreal, has three new sexual assault charges brought against him.

Dominic Blanchette had already been charged last spring. The teacher was already facing six counts including sexual assault on an 11-year-old girl.

The charges against the suspect last May took place between December 24, 2021 and May 27, 2022.

He is also charged with possession of child pornography, sharing sexually explicit material and invitation to sexual touching.

“After the first file, there was an appeal launched by the [Service de police de la Ville de Montréal]. Subsequently, there was a second file in which there were 16 charges related to a total of five victims, “explained the Crown prosecutor, Me Annabelle Sheppard.

The Center de services scolaire de la Pointe-de-l'Île (CSSPI) had quickly suspended the teacher when the first charges were brought against him.

Dominic Blanchette will return to court on August 31 for his investigation into his release. His mother is expected to testify that day.
